d4 Calculator Formula and Mathematical Explanation

The mathematics behind a d4 calculator revolves around probability and statistics. The core calculation for the average roll is straightforward.

Average Roll Formula:

Average = (N × 2.5) + M

Where:

  • N is the number of d4 dice.
  • 2.5 is the statistical mean of a single d4. (1+2+3+4) / 4 = 2.5.
  • M is the total modifier.

To calculate the full probability distribution, the d4 calculator determines every possible combination of dice rolls. For example, rolling two d4s has 4 × 4 = 16 possible outcomes. The tool counts how many combinations result in each possible sum (e.g., a sum of 5 can be achieved by rolling 1+4, 2+3, 3+2, or 4+1). This allows the d4 calculator to display the exact probability of achieving any given total.

Practical Examples (Real-World Use Cases)

Example 1: Guiding Bolt Spell

A low-level Cleric casts Guiding Bolt, which deals 4d6 radiant damage. But let’s imagine a homebrew version that uses d4s for a weaker cantrip, dealing 3d4 damage. The player wants to know if it’s worth using the spell on an enemy with 8 hit points.

  • Inputs for d4 calculator: Number of Dice = 3, Modifier = 0.
  • Calculator Output:
    • Average Roll: 7.5
    • Minimum Roll: 3
    • Maximum Roll: 12
    • Probability to roll 8 or higher: ~42%

Interpretation: The Cleric can see there’s a decent chance to defeat the enemy in one hit, but it’s far from guaranteed. The average roll won’t quite be enough. This information, provided by the d4 calculator, helps them decide whether to risk it or use a more reliable attack.

Example 2: Potion of Healing

A player drinks a standard Potion of Healing, which restores 2d4+2 hit points. They are currently at 3 HP and want to gauge how much health they will likely recover.

  • Inputs for d4 calculator: Number of Dice = 2, Modifier = +2.
  • Calculator Output:
    • Average Roll: 7.0
    • Minimum Roll: 4
    • Maximum Roll: 10

Interpretation: The player can be confident they will recover at least 4 HP, bringing them to 7 HP total. On average, they’ll recover 7 HP. This d4 calculator shows them that drinking the potion is a safe and effective choice.

Key Factors That Affect d4 Calculator Results

Several factors can influence the outcome of a dice roll and the results you see in a d4 calculator.

  • Number of Dice: The more dice you roll, the more the results will cluster around the average. Rolling 1d4 has an equal chance for any number, but rolling 3d4 makes results like 7 or 8 much more common than 3 or 12. This is a key principle of dice statistics.
  • Modifiers: A flat bonus or penalty directly shifts the entire range of outcomes. A +2 modifier increases the minimum, maximum, and average roll by 2.
  • Advantage and Disadvantage: While not directly modeled in this specific d4 calculator, the concept of rolling twice and taking the higher (advantage) or lower (disadvantage) roll significantly skews probabilities. You can learn more about this in guides on advantage and disadvantage 5e.
  • Die Type: This is a d4 calculator, but using a d6 or d8 would produce vastly different results. A d6 damage calculator would show a higher average and maximum roll.
  • Critical Hits: In many games, rolling a natural maximum on a d20 doubles the damage dice. Factoring in the chance of a critical hit adds another layer to damage calculations. It’s a key part of understanding critical hit chance.
  • Damage Resistance/Vulnerability: If a target has resistance, the final damage is halved. If they have vulnerability, it’s doubled. This happens after the roll and is a crucial strategic consideration that works in tandem with the results from the d4 calculator.

Frequently Asked Questions (FAQ)

1. What is the average roll for a single d4?
The average roll of a single 4-sided die is 2.5. You calculate this by summing the faces (1+2+3+4=10) and dividing by the number of faces (4).
2. Why use a d4 calculator instead of just rolling dice?
A d4 calculator is for statistical analysis, not just generating a random number. It tells you the probability of all possible outcomes *before* you roll, helping you make more informed strategic decisions.
3. How does rolling more dice change the probability?
As you add more dice, the probability distribution changes from a flat line (for 1 die) to a bell curve. This means results in the middle of the range become much more likely, and extreme high or low results become much rarer. Our d4 calculator visualizes this effect perfectly.

5. What does ‘cumulative probability’ mean in the table?
Cumulative probability is the chance of rolling a certain sum *or less*. It’s useful for seeing the probability of meeting or failing a certain threshold. For example, a cumulative probability of 75% for a sum of 9 means there’s a 75% chance you’ll roll a 9 or lower.

8. Does the shape of a d4 matter?
Assuming the die is fair, the shape (tetrahedron vs. a 12-sided die numbered 1-4 three times) does not change the statistical probability. Each number still has a 1-in-4 chance of being rolled. This d4 calculator operates on that statistical principle.
